About this sunscreen

Equate Ultra Light Broad Spectrum Sunscreen Lotion SPF 50 is a chemical lotion using just avobenzone and homosalate, an older and minimal filter pairing. It wears matte and lightweight with a low white cast and generally low pore-clogging risk, though it can mildly sting near the eyes. Despite the SPF 50 label, our rating scores its protection as weak, which caps the overall result. The score of 49.0/100 reflects that limited filter set, so heavier sun exposure may call for a stronger option.

Is Equate Ultra Light Sunscreen SPF 50 good?

It scores 49.0/100, a low rating. Despite the SPF 50 label, our rating scores its protection as weak because it relies on just two older filters, which caps the overall result.

Is the Equate Ultra Light Broad Spectrum Sunscreen Lotion For All Skin Tones SPF 50 mineral or chemical?

It is a chemical sunscreen using only avobenzone and homosalate, an older and minimal filter pairing. It contains no mineral filters.

Does it leave a white cast?

White cast is rated low, so it generally blends in. The finish is matte and lightweight, though it can mildly sting near the eyes.
